X by Sue Grafton Book Summary

“An inventive plot and incisive character studies elevate MWA Grand Master Grafton’s twenty-fourth Kinsey Millhone novel...This superior outing will remind readers why this much-loved series will be missed as the end of the alphabet approaches.”—Publishers Weekly (starred review)

X:  The number ten. An unknown quantity. A mistake. A cross. A kiss...

Perhaps Sue Grafton’s darkest and most chilling novel, X features a remorseless serial killer who leaves no trace of his crimes. Once again breaking the rules and establishing new paths, Grafton wastes little time identifying this deadly sociopath. The test is whether private investigator Kinsey Millhone can prove her case against him—before she becomes his next victim.

X. Sue Grafton wrote an unusual mystery for her in that the major culprit is known by mid-book and by the end of the book his crimes certain, he is on the run from law enforcement. Two interesting side stories about squatters and a wealthy couple fighting and getting back together are included. The couple was the most interesting.

Difficult Being A PI. Kinsey is your neighbor next door that has found her professional niche, investigating. Over the years she has sought to improve her skills as well as utilize them to bring issues brought to her attention to a successful closure. In this book, there are three issues. One where she is hired to perform a simple task for her skill set that turns into something else. Second where a new neighbor is a cause for concern. And lastly, doing a favor for a friend on behalf of the friend's deceased husband uncovers something entirely different. Like life, not everything has a desirable outcome.
